Strange how both were honed to 20k synthetic. Yet the Gevoso HHT was great. And the Fram was poor ...pasted strop hardly improved the Fram , yet both are 6/8 deep hollow grinds from the same period, both renowned Solingen makers . However much to my surprise, both shaved extremely well !😮 🫢 .
Easy to use Cajun Blade soap. ' Forět de Pins' wonderful aroma .
My trusty synthetic Yaqi 30mm brush , never fails .
4 passes and a totally comfortable shave ....
